summaryrefslogtreecommitdiff
path: root/gtk/gtkpopovermenu.h
diff options
context:
space:
mode:
authorMatthias Clasen <mclasen@redhat.com>2019-03-27 17:52:51 -0400
committerMatthias Clasen <mclasen@redhat.com>2019-03-27 17:53:48 -0400
commit4a1019bed03ff685b12b776dfefa5b4568dd6947 (patch)
tree4ed49584d0aa6ec5618841f910c0d64f7d77ae18 /gtk/gtkpopovermenu.h
parente5722367b3e8f6b0a0f2061a17a31c2878da3f21 (diff)
downloadgtk+-4a1019bed03ff685b12b776dfefa5b4568dd6947.tar.gz
popover menu: Add an api for adding submenus
This is a step towards removing the submenu child property.
Diffstat (limited to 'gtk/gtkpopovermenu.h')
-rw-r--r--gtk/gtkpopovermenu.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/gtk/gtkpopovermenu.h b/gtk/gtkpopovermenu.h
index c920f5c627..bf041b02ea 100644
--- a/gtk/gtkpopovermenu.h
+++ b/gtk/gtkpopovermenu.h
@@ -53,8 +53,12 @@ GDK_AVAILABLE_IN_ALL
GtkWidget * gtk_popover_menu_new (void);
GDK_AVAILABLE_IN_ALL
+void gtk_popover_menu_add_submenu (GtkPopoverMenu *popover,
+ GtkWidget *menu,
+ const char *name);
+GDK_AVAILABLE_IN_ALL
void gtk_popover_menu_open_submenu (GtkPopoverMenu *popover,
- const gchar *name);
+ const char *name);
G_END_DECLS